Primrose Hill School
Scope of Work
Key elements of the project included:
Structural Modifications: Removal of structural walls in the library, breakfast area, and reception classrooms to reconfigure spaces.
Partition Installation: Erection of new partitions to create additional rooms tailored to the school’s needs.
Interior Fit-Out: Comprehensive fit-out of newly created areas, featuring suspended ceilings, modern light fittings, decorative finishes, and new flooring.
Project Overview
The renovation of Primrose Hill Primary School involved significant internal alterations, including the relocation of mechanical and electrical (M&E) fixtures and fittings. This project required careful planning and coordination, as the school remained occupied throughout the construction period.
